The Science Behind the Storm
So what caused this sudden burst of atmospheric fury? Meteorologists point to a combination of factors. A low-pressure system moving in from the Atlantic collided with warm, moist air lingering over southern England. This clash created the perfect conditions for thunderstorms, with the added twist of hail—a relatively rare phenomenon in London but increasingly common as temperatures rise. The Met Office noted that the storm was part of a larger pattern of convective activity, where warm air rises rapidly, condensing into towering cumulonimbus clouds that unleash their fury in minutes.
Climate scientists warn that such storms could become more frequent as global temperatures continue to climb. The UK’s average temperature has risen by about 1°C since the pre-industrial era, and this extra heat provides more energy for storms to draw from. While individual weather events can’t be directly attributed to climate change, the increasing intensity of storms like Tuesday’s aligns with predictions made by climate models. Lessons from London’s Storm: A Call for Preparedness
As the storm subsided and the skies cleared, Londoners were left with more than just wet shoes and soggy newspapers. They were left with a question: How can a city of nearly 9 million people better prepare for the next inevitable storm? The answer lies in a combination of short-term fixes and long-term planning.
For starters, the city could invest in better drainage systems to prevent flooding, especially in low-lying areas like parts of South London and the Docklands. The UK government has already pledged £5.2 billion for flood defense schemes by 2027, but critics argue that more needs to be done to accelerate these projects. Additionally, public awareness campaigns could educate residents on how to stay safe during extreme weather, from avoiding flooded underpasses to knowing the signs of a lightning strike.
